Real Estate CRM Software Overview

Real estate CRM software is a customer relationship management system specifically designed for the real estate industry. It helps real estate agents manage their client relationships, maintain properties and track leads and convert them into sales.

Real estate CRM software can provide agents with a comprehensive set of tools to help them reach out to prospects, create relationships, generate leads, and convert those leads into sales. The software is primarily used to assist in marketing activities, such as email campaigns and other forms of outreach. It also provides business insights that make it easier for agents to analyze their market activity and trends. Additionally, the software can be used to track property listings and offers, as well as manage transactions and contracts.

The main features of real estate CRM software include contact management; lead generation; transaction tracking; contract generation; marketing automation; analytics/reporting; email notifications; task management; calendar reminders; document storage; website integration; mobile support; data import/export capabilities. All of these features are combined to create an automated system that streamlines the process of managing clients’ needs from start to finish.

Real estate CRM software helps real estate professionals organize their workflows by providing an intuitive interface allowing users to easily access contacts quickly, search for properties or persons on their database, assign tasks or view report summaries on any given day — all at hand on one platform. The software also allows users to quickly send emails or SMS messages from within the platform as well as schedule appointments or follow-up calls with potential buyers or sellers automatically via calendars built-in the system’s automated workflows — all while staying compliant with local regulations like G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ation).

Overall, real estate CRM software helps busy real estate professionals stay organized while growing their businesses faster than ever before possible due its automation capabilities which makes life easier and more efficient in today’s fast-paced markets.

Real Estate CRM Software Features

  1. Contact Management: Real estate CRM software offers the ability to store and manage contact information for customers, vendors, and stakeholders in an organized manner. This feature enables users to easily update contact details and make sure that everyone is kept in the loop.
  2. Lead Tracking and Management: This feature allows users to track leads from initial contact to closing or converting them into a customer. It also helps users prioritize leads by adding tags and assigning tasks to team members to ensure timely follow-up.
  3. Reporting and Analytics: Real estate CRM software provides insights into user performance with the help of analytics and reporting tools. These comprehensive reports enable users to identify potential areas of improvement and measure the success of their campaigns.
  4. Automation: This feature helps streamline workflows by automating mundane tasks such as sending emails and follow-ups, setting reminders, and updating customer information. This ensures that the user does not have to manually perform these tedious tasks and can focus on more important activities.
  5. Document Management: This feature allows users to store and manage documents such as contracts and forms in a centralized location. This helps ensure that all essential documents are readily available when needed.
  6. Collaboration Tools: Real estate CRM software includes collaboration features such as chats, discussion boards, and file-sharing so that team members can stay connected and work together effectively.

What Types of Users Can Benefit From Real Estate CRM Software?

  • Real Estate Agents: CRM software makes it easy for real estate agents to store and organize their contacts, track activity, and communicate with leads.
  • Brokerage Firms: A CRM system allows brokers to monitor the performance of agents in their organization and identify trends that may require attention. This can help make sure operations are running smoothly.
  • Property Managers: With a CRM, property managers are able to better manage tenant inquiries and leasing contracts while staying on top of maintenance tasks. By organizing tenant data in one place they can automate common tasks such as rent reminders or lease renewals.
  • Landlords: Using a real estate CRM enables landlords to easily advertise vacancies, collect applications from prospective tenants, review past history and references, send paperwork electronically – all while keeping organizational records secure.
  • Developers: Automation features found in real estate CRMs allow developers to save time when processing project information such as financials, estimating costs or creating proposals for investors or lenders. Additionally, they can use workflow functionalities like auto-strategies that streamline the process from idea to successful development project completion.
  • Homebuyers & Sellers: To stay organized throughout their home buying or selling journey consumers can use mobile apps connected to a real estate CRM system which provides useful information about properties accessible with just a few clicks of the mouse.

How Much Does Real Estate CRM Software Cost?

Real estate CRM software can vary in cost depending on the features and functionality that you need. Prices typically range from free (with limited features) to hundreds or even thousands of dollars per month for more comprehensive solutions with advanced customization capabilities and support.

For a basic CRM, you should be able to find an entry-level solution for free or for around $20-$30/month. These starter plans are useful for real estate agents who just require basic contact management and tracking capabilities.

On the higher end of the spectrum, you may find yourself paying up to hundreds of dollars per month based on your team’s size and the number of users needed. Most mid-tier options will provide advanced automation tools, integration options, marketing campaign tracking and more at prices ranging from $50-$100/month per user. Additionally, some providers offer custom plans tailored specifically to your needs that could cost as much as several hundred dollars/month.

Finally, some vendors may also offer discounts if you purchase a plan annually instead of monthly – so it pays off to do some research before committing.

Risks Associated With Real Estate CRM Software

  • Security: With any software system, there is always a risk of data being compromised by unauthorized access or cyber-attacks. This can lead to the leakage of sensitive customer information and put businesses in breach of compliance regulations.
  • Data Loss: There is always a risk that important data could be lost due to technical errors or natural disasters such as fires, floods, and power outages. Without proper backups in place this can have serious ramifications for business operations.
  • System Outages: Real estate CRM platforms are complex systems that require regular maintenance and updates in order to remain reliable and secure. If these updates don’t happen regularly then it increases the chances of system outages which can halt business operations until rectified.
  • Cost Overruns: The cost of implementing real estate CRM software can often be underestimated leading to cost overruns if additional hardware or features become necessary over time.
  • Person-to-Person Errors: Despite automated processes, humans still play an integral part in day-to-day operations which opens up the possibility for mistakes like incorrect data entry or failure to follow instructions correctly when using the system.
